AKC Meet the Breeds .... The Dachshund
The Dachshund, meaning "badger dog" in German, is a lively breed with a friendly personality and keen sense of smell. Known for their long and low bodies, they are eager hunters that excel in both above- and below-ground work. One of the most popular breeds according to AKC. They come in three different coat varieties (Smooth, Wirehaired or Longhaired) and can be miniature or standard size.
A Look Back at the Dachshund:
Dachshunds were first bred in the early 1600s in Germany. The goal was to create a fearless, elongated dog that could dig the earth from a badger burrow and fight to the death with the vicious badgers.
Right Breed for You?
Dachshunds are lovable, playful companions, and an ideal pet for many homes, including those with children with appropriate supervision. They require moderate exercise, and can adapt to most living environments. Depending on their coat type, Dachshunds may need regular grooming.

- Hound Group; AKC recognized in 1885.
- Dachshunds can be standard or miniature size. Standards range from 16-32 pounds,
- while Miniatures weigh 11 pounds and under at 1 year of age. Average miniature 9-14 pounds
- Badger hunter, family companion.
